ToolVS

Tailwind CSS vs Bootstrap (2026): Which CSS Framework Should You Choose?

Quick Answer

Tailwind CSS is the modern default for custom design work — utility-first classes, no CSS specificity conflicts, tiny production bundles, and exceptional design system flexibility. Bootstrap is the classic for rapid prototyping with pre-built components — if you need a working nav, modal, and grid in 10 minutes, Bootstrap is faster. For modern React/Vue/Next.js projects in 2026, Tailwind CSS has become the dominant choice among developers.

Tailwind CSS

9.2/10

Best custom design flexibility

Bootstrap

8.3/10

Best rapid prototyping

Feature Comparison

FeatureTailwind CSSBootstrap
ApproachUtility-first — compose classes in HTMLComponent-based — pre-built UI components
Bundle Size<10KB production (PurgeCSS)~30KB minified+gzip (full CSS)
CustomizationFully customizable via tailwind.configSass variables — extensive but more complex
Pre-built ComponentsNone built-in (Headless UI, shadcn/ui)Complete component library included
Design ConsistencyEnforced via design tokens/configEnforced via component defaults
Dark ModeBuilt-in dark: variantSupported via data-bs-theme attribute
Learning CurveModerate — memorize utility classesLow — classes are self-explanatory
Best ForCustom design, React/Vue/Next.js appsRapid prototyping, admin panels, backend tools

Which do you use?

Tailwind CSS
Bootstrap

Who Should Choose What?

Choose Tailwind CSS if:

You are building a product with a custom design that should not look like Bootstrap. Tailwind's utility classes keep all styling in your component files (no switching between HTML and CSS), the PurgeCSS integration keeps production bundles tiny, and the ecosystem (shadcn/ui, Headless UI, Radix UI) provides accessible components that you can style however you want.

Choose Bootstrap if:

You need to build a functional UI quickly — internal tools, admin dashboards, prototypes — and do not need a custom design. Bootstrap 5 (no jQuery dependency) is still the fastest way to get a responsive, functional interface working. Every web developer knows Bootstrap, making it easy to hand off to other developers.

FAQ

Is Tailwind CSS or Bootstrap better for web development?
Tailwind CSS is better for custom designs in modern frameworks (React, Next.js, Vue). Bootstrap is better for rapid prototyping with pre-built components. For new projects in 2026, Tailwind CSS has become the developer community's default choice.
Is Tailwind CSS faster than Bootstrap?
In production, Tailwind CSS generates much smaller CSS bundles (<10KB vs Bootstrap's ~30KB). During development, Bootstrap can be faster for initial setup since components are pre-built. For performance-critical production apps, Tailwind wins clearly.

Get our free SaaS Buyer's Guide (PDF)

Save hours of research. We cover pricing traps, hidden fees, and how to negotiate better deals.

Join 0 SaaS buyers. No spam, unsubscribe anytime.

Share:𝕏infr/

Related Comparisons

Vercel vs Netlify
Vercel winsDeveloper Tools
Read comparison →
Vercel vs AWS Amplify
Vercel winsDeveloper Tools
Read comparison →
Vercel vs Cloudflare Pages
Vercel winsDeveloper Tools
Read comparison →
Vercel vs Railway
Vercel winsDeveloper Tools
Read comparison →
Coolify vs Vercel
Vercel winsDeveloper Tools
Read comparison →
GitHub vs GitLab
GitHub winsDeveloper Tools
Read comparison →

Last updated: